EnglishFrançaisItaliano Google Traduction

 

 
Per valutare e confrontare le diverse calcolatrici programmabili, ho scritto dei piccoli programmi di prova applicati a ciascuna di esse.


Test "Forensics"
L'algoritmo "forensics" è stato inventato da Mike Sebastian per fornire rapidamente un confronto dell'accuratezza delle calcolatrici scientifiche.
Si tratta di applicare il seguente calcolo e di osservare il risultato ottenuto:
arcsin(arccos(arctan(tan(cos(sin(9))))))

(Vedi "Calculator Forensics" di Mike Sebastian)


Ma... la precisione del calcolo (numero di cifre decimali dopo la virgola) influenzerà il risultato finale...


 :Programmi "Forensics" :
Test fattoriale
Anche per calcolatrici con funzione "fattoriale", sono stati scritti programmi per poter confrontare queste calcolatrici con altre.


 Programmi "Fattoriali" :
La formula di Stirling
La formula di Stirling permette di approssimare il fattoriale di un numero.


 Programmi "Stirling" :
Test "Fibonacci"
Trovare il numero di Fibonacci di rango n.


 Programmi "Fibonacci" :
La formula di Binet
La formula di Binet fornisce il n-esimo termine della sequenza Fibonacci.


 Programmi "Binet" :
Il cerchio
Quale programma potrebbe essere applicato a tutte le calcolatrici programmabili ?


 Programmi "cerchio" :
Massimo Comub Divisore
Uno dei classici programmini di programmazione per calcolatrici...


 Programmi "MCD" :
Paradosso del compleanno
Il paradosso del compleanno calcola la probabilità percentuale di trovare 2 persone con lo stesso compleanno (non necessariamente nate nello stesso anno) in un gruppo di n persone.


 Programmi "Compleanno" :
La formula di Ramanujan permette di calcolare il fattoriale di un numero.


 Programmi "Ramanujan" :

Alcuni programmatori, abituati alle calcolatrici programmabili per le quali ho scritto dei programmi, potrebbero essere sorpresi dal mio stile di programmazione.

Per tutte le calcolatrici della mia collezione, a parte quelle che conoscevo perfettamente come la TI58C, ho preso come vincolo il non utilizzo di alcuna documentazione per iniziare con la macchina e programmarla.

È stato molto facile per alcune macchine ma piuttosto laborioso per altre, ma ce l'ho fatta senza violare la regola che mi ero prefissata.

Paradosso quando voglio avere per ogni macchina la sua documentazione più completa possibile... ma non mi proibisco, quando la calcolatrice è "padroneggiata", di leggere i manuali o libri diversi come altri leggerebbero romanzi.








Home

Segnalibro ed azione


Firefox      SeaMonkey      Opera      Google Chrome     
Better support with Firefox, SeaMonkey, Opera, Google Chrome
Use of JavaScript

Screen 1024x768 - colors 16 bit or more



  Ultimo aggiornamento su 11 Maggio 2024

Site created with PHweb © 2009/2024 Pierre Houbert